Iyaas is a distinguished Arabic name with deep linguistic roots and historical significance in Islamic culture. Meaning ‘compensation’ or ‘recompense’, this name carries connotations of fairness, restoration, and justice. Used primarily for boys, Iyaas has been borne by notable figures throughout Arab and Islamic history. Its elegant sound and meaningful origin make it a thoughtful choice for parents seeking a name with substance.

Origin & Cultural Significance

Iyaas originates from classical Arabic and has been used since pre-Islamic times among Arab tribes. The name gained prominence in early Islamic history with figures like Iyas ibn Mu’awiyah, an 8th century judge renowned for his wisdom in Basra. As Arabic spread with Islam, the name was adopted in various Muslim cultures including Persian, Urdu, and Turkish contexts. While primarily used in Muslim communities due to its Arabic origin, the name’s meaning is linguistic rather than specifically religious. Historical records show the name appearing in genealogies, poetry, and biographical dictionaries across the Arab world.

Famous People Named Iyaas

  • Iyas ibn Mu'awiyah — 8th century Islamic judge and scholar from Basra known for his wisdom and judicial rulings
  • Iyas ibn Qabisah al-Ta'i — Pre-Islamic Arab poet and warrior from the Tayy tribe
